Versions:
Kopete 0.12.5 (KDE 3.5.7) Czech translation
Description:
I install some new package/motive (for example new emoticons) via Settings ->
Appeareance -> Download new motive. It works good, i can choose whatever and
click on "install". Later i want to remove the emoticons package, i will remove
it via Settings -> Appereance -> Remove motive. But now is the bug, i can not
install it again via Settings -> Download new motive -> install motive, it
seems that it is still instaled, but i do not see it in my list of emoticons
packs.
I found the solution, i have to open the file
/home/user/.kde/share/config/kopeterc and remove the row with a log
about the installed package.
This means: Kopete does not remove logs from named path. And the same
problem is with the installed and uninstalled packages for appearance of
chat window.
